                             1971 YAMAHA DT1MX 250



THIS IS A FACTORY MOTOCROSS MOTORCYCLE.. IT IS IN NEED OF TOTAL RESTORATION..

THIS IS A GOOD FOUNDATION TO BUILD A BEAUTIFUL, HIGHLY COLLECTABLE PIECE OF YAMAHA MOTOCROSS HISTORY. I JUST DON'T HAVE THE TIME. MOST ALL PIECES AND HARDWARE ARE AVAILABLE HERE ON EBAY FOR THIS BIKE..

THIS DT1 250 MX HAS MATCHING FRAME AND ENGINE NUMBERS, DT1-90969.. 

ALL FACTORY GYT PARTS ARE THERE, 285 CARBURETOR, LARGE AIRBOX, CYLINDER AND HEAD, NICE FACTORY GYT EXPANSION CHAMBER.

ENGINE WILL NOT TURN OVER. I HAVE HAD THIS FOR ABOUT ONE YEAR, WHEN I TOOK IT AS TRADE IT DID TURN OVER.. SIDE CASES ARE THERE AND NOT CRACKED OR BROKEN, ALL FINS ON CYLINDER AND HEAD ARE GOOD. NICE KICK START LEVER AND GEAR SHIFT LEVER. OIL INJECTOR IS NOT HOOKED UP. APPEARS TO SHIFT THROUGH THE GEARS..

TANK IS NOT PERFECT BUT WILL RESTORE NICELY. BIGGEST DENT IS ON RIGHT SIDE. 

VERY NICE CORRECT ORIGINAL ALUMINUM FRONT FENDER AND MOUNT.. REAR FENDER IS NOT PERFECT BUT WITH SOME EFFORT WILL STRAIGHTEN OUT NICELY.

FRAME APPEARS SOLID.. KICKSTAND IS THERE. 

SEAT PAN SHOULD WORK IF YOU CHOOSE TO USE IT, IT DOES HAVE RUST AND A FEW SMALL PIN HOLES..

HANDLEBARS APPEAR STRAIGHT BUT THE CHROME IS NOT PERFECT. YAMAHA LEVERS AND PERCHES, CORRECT THROTTLE.

MotoGP Axes Claiming Rule and Adjusts Moto2 Engine Swap Fees

Wed, 03 Jul 2013

The International Motorcycling Federation‘s Grand Prix Commission officially annulled MotoGP‘s Claiming Rule. Effective immediately, teams using the official spec Magneti Marelli ECU hardware and software are exempt from having their engines claimed. Starting in the 2014 season however, the claiming rule will be cancelled completely.
